dc.descriptionA Digital Global Map of Irrigated Areas is a publication related to the GMIA version 1. This paper, published on ICID Journal, 49(2), 55-66, describes the dataset, the data and map sources as well as the map generation, and it discusses the data uncertainty. The digital global map of irrigated areas was developed for the purpose of global modeling of water use and crop production, The map depicts the percentage of each 0.5˚ by 0.5˚ cell that was equipped for irrigation in 1995. It was derived by combining information from large-scale maps with outlines of irrigated areas (one or more countries per map), FAO data on totala irrigated area per country in 1995 and national data on total irrigated area per country, drainage basin or federal state.
